Kokomo Healthcare Center is a long-term care facility located at 429 W Lincoln Rd in Kokomo, Indiana (ZIP 46902) in Howard County. The facility operates under for-profit corporate ownership and holds certification for both Medicare and Medicaid. It maintains 80 certified beds and is currently active. The facility holds an overall CMS star rating of 3 out of 5, which aligns with the national average of 3.0 stars. CMS star ratings are based on three component areas: health inspections, staffing levels, and quality measures. Kokomo Healthcare Center received a 3-star rating in health inspections, indicating performance in line with national norms for that category. Its staffing rating is 1 star, the lowest rating on the five-point scale, suggesting staffing levels below what CMS considers adequate relative to other facilities nationally. In contrast, the quality measure rating is 5 stars, the highest possible, reflecting clinical quality indicators that exceed national benchmarks in that category. About CMS Star Ratings

CMS assigns 1–5 star ratings to Medicare and Medicaid-certified nursing homes based on three domains: health inspections, staffing levels, and quality measures. The overall rating is a weighted composite.

A 5-star overall rating does not guarantee excellence in every domain — inspect each sub-rating independently. Data is updated quarterly.
